What does a spectroscopy professional do?

Daily responsibilities for a spectroscopy professional often include preparing and analyzing samples, calibrating and maintaining spectroscopic instruments, recording and interpreting data, and reporting findings to supervisors or project teams. You may also be involved in developing new analytical methods, troubleshooting equipment issues, and ensuring compliance with laboratory safety standards. Collaboration with colleagues from research, quality control, or engineering departments is common, fostering a multidisciplinary environment. This variety of tasks keeps the work engaging and provides ample opportunities to expand technical expertise and problem-solving skills.

What skills and qualifications are needed for spectroscopy?

To thrive in a spectroscopy role, you need a strong background in chemistry or physics, excellent analytical skills, and experience with quantitative analysis methods. Familiarity with spectroscopic instruments like FTIR, NMR, or mass spectrometers, as well as proficiency in data analysis software and possibly relevant certifications, is essential. Attention to detail, critical thinking, and effective communication elevate performance in this position. These skills enable accurate data interpretation, reliable experiment execution, and collaboration in research or industrial settings.

What is spectroscopy?

A Spectroscopy job involves the study and analysis of how matter interacts with electromagnetic radiation. Professionals in this field use various spectroscopic techniques, such as UV-Vis, infrared (IR), nuclear magnetic resonance (NMR), and mass spectrometry, to identify and characterize chemical substances. These roles are common in industries like pharmaceuticals, environmental science, forensics, and material research. Responsibilities may include operating and maintaining spectroscopic instruments, interpreting spectral data, and developing new analytical methods.

What careers use spectroscopy?

Spectroscopy is used in careers such as analytical chemists, physicists, materials scientists, and laboratory technicians. These professionals work in industries like pharmaceuticals, environmental testing, food safety, and research laboratories, often utilizing specialized instruments and techniques to analyze substances and materials.
